你查询的IP:[119.26.157.76]  地理位置:日本

最新查询119.90.136.77 221.216.60.51 218.16.136.55 60.156.90.235 122.64.0.92 120.18.38.102 218.117.63.82 60.228.134.50 117.22.186.234 119.26.157.76 123.160.25.179 202.125.176.198 125.98.103.111 203.212.80.147 118.132.123.171 116.13.142.173 123.49.128.230 210.14.128.119 119.128.95.43 119.128.199.248 202.149.224.103 125.61.128.204 202.43.144.208 119.96.204.100 202.127.212.4 58.14.73.42 125.61.128.166 125.208.31.239 202.127.12.36 203.135.160.131 117.76.85.81